Who are we?

The Scouts is the UK’s largest youth organisation, and the world’s largest youth movement. We prepare young people with Skills for Life.

We are Stevenage Scout District, home to nine Scout Groups across Stevenage, Knebworth, and Datchworth. ‘Scout Group’s are the local units of Scouting where young people aged 4 to 14 are organised into sections (Squirrels, Beavers, Cubs, Scouts) At District level we provide Scouting for young people aged 14 to 25 in the Explorer section and Scout Network.

Stevenage is one of the Districts that make up Hertfordshire Scout County, which provides wider support and guidance to local Scouting. Find out about how it all fits together here.

District Shop

We have a District Scout Shop, based at our District HQ, Poplars that sells uniform, badges, record cards and various publications. Printed copies of the yellow card are available to members. The shop is open on Monday evenings during term time between 7:30 and 9:00pm. Some groups have accounts for group purchases. The Scout Shop is also a good place to drop in if you wish to meet members of the District team. A meeting room is also available.

Email

Email is our primary method of communication to volunteers within the District. We have a Microsoft Office 365 Tennant that allows us to provide volunteers with a Stevenage Scouting email address as well as online versions of the Microsoft Office Apps and a Scouting Onedrive . If you already have a Scouting email address, just let us know so we can ensure you are on the correct email distribution lists.

For more information on the Stevenage Scouting email and Microsoft 365, and to request an account, please visit our email page.

For larger email distributions we use Zoho Campaigns to send our emails.

Facebook

We have a public Facebook page which we use to publicise our activities. We encourage parents, volunteers and our supporters to follow this page. As it is a public page, we will be careful to limit the details of events publicised.

A private Facebook group is available to all volunteers within the District. Most of the general information and news that is emailed out is also shared to the Facebook group.
